diff options
author | Jesse Plamondon-Willard <Pathoschild@users.noreply.github.com> | 2022-04-11 23:20:20 -0400 |
---|---|---|
committer | GitHub <noreply@github.com> | 2022-04-11 23:20:20 -0400 |
commit | 9fbed0fa1f28a9b0fe0b952a78b10e2d475adb03 (patch) | |
tree | fc57c1e55d0f8887d2fbfc30a2873ded8281906d /src | |
parent | 1e61309d3dce484d5b646b1a8d15c825beac813f (diff) | |
parent | 25e0b4b8ada9ce7aa02f9eafaf5e0609977685c4 (diff) | |
download | SMAPI-9fbed0fa1f28a9b0fe0b952a78b10e2d475adb03.tar.gz SMAPI-9fbed0fa1f28a9b0fe0b952a78b10e2d475adb03.tar.bz2 SMAPI-9fbed0fa1f28a9b0fe0b952a78b10e2d475adb03.zip |
Merge pull request #839 from nuztalgia/develop
Ignore dot-prefixed files when scanning for mods
Diffstat (limited to 'src')
-rw-r--r-- | src/SMAPI.Toolkit/Framework/ModScanning/ModScanner.cs |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/src/SMAPI.Toolkit/Framework/ModScanning/ModScanner.cs b/src/SMAPI.Toolkit/Framework/ModScanning/ModScanner.cs index 2af30092..12333c4e 100644 --- a/src/SMAPI.Toolkit/Framework/ModScanning/ModScanner.cs +++ b/src/SMAPI.Toolkit/Framework/ModScanning/ModScanner.cs @@ -306,8 +306,8 @@ namespace StardewModdingAPI.Toolkit.Framework.ModScanning /// <param name="entry">The file or folder.</param> private bool IsRelevant(FileSystemInfo entry) { - // ignored file extension - if (entry is FileInfo file && this.IgnoreFileExtensions.Contains(file.Extension)) + // ignored file extensions and any files starting with "." + if ((entry is FileInfo file) && (this.IgnoreFileExtensions.Contains(file.Extension) || file.Name.StartsWith("."))) return false; // ignored entry name |